(UPDATE #1) CenterPoint Substation Fire in Northwest Houston, Shelter In Place Issued
Houston Firefighters arrived at 9:44 a.m. this morning, July 9, 2021 in the 2105 block of Brittmoore within six minutes and found a CenterPoint Energy Substation on fire. A defensive attack was requested and multiple units are on scene including HFD Hazmat and Rehab. Pearland, Community and Stafford are also assisting.
